As the largest pureplay adhesives company in the world, H.B. Fuller’s (NYSE: FUL) innovative, functional coatings, adhesives and sealants enhance the quality, safety and performance of products people use every day. Founded in 1887, with 2024 revenue of $3.6 billion, our mission to Connect What Matters is brought to life by more than 7,500 global team members who collaborate with customers across more than 30 market segments in over 140 countries to develop highly specified solutions that enable customers to bring world-changing innovations to their end markets. Position Overview

The Senior Project Engineer supports the Building Adhesive Solutions (BAS) global manufacturing network by leading high‑visibility, complex capital projects from concept through commissioning. Reporting to the BAS Global Project Engineering Manager, this role is responsible for delivering projects on time and within budget while supporting capacity growth, automation, and operational excellence across multiple facilities.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Lead and execute complex capital projects using the corporate CAPEX Stage Gate process from initiation through commissioning.

  • Manage project scope, schedules, and budgets to ensure on‑time, within‑budget delivery.

  • Prepare capital expenditure requests, cost estimates, project proposals, and business justifications.

  • Develop engineering specifications, bid packages, and contractor scopes in alignment with corporate standards.

  • Evaluate manufacturing operations for automation, productivity improvement, and cost‑reduction opportunities.

  • Oversee procurement, construction, installation, and start‑up of new manufacturing systems (“cradle‑to‑grave” ownership).

  • Coordinate cross‑functional teams and plant resources to minimize downtime during project execution.

  • Screen, hire, and manage contractors; direct internal support personnel and vendors to complete project objectives.

  • Review and approve engineering drawings, equipment selections, and vendor proposals.

  • Ensure all projects comply with environmental, safety, and regulatory requirements, including proper operator training and startup readiness.

Minimum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ering

  • 7+ years of manufacturing engineering experience with a proven record of project execution

  • Experience leading multiple capital projects valued at $250K or greater

  • Demonstrated project leadership or program management experience

  • Knowledge of plant safety requirements including machine guarding, lockout/tagout, and confined space entry

  • Strong financial acumen, including understanding of IRR and NPV calculations

  • Proficiency with AutoCAD and Microsoft Office tools, including Microsoft Project

Preferred Requirements

  • Experience in chemical manufacturing environments with liquid and/or powder processes

  • PMP certification or equivalent capital project management experience

  • Experience in batch process manufacturing operations

  • Demonstrated process improvement experience (Lean, Six Sigma, RCCA, Theory of Constraints)

  • Experience supporting PHAs, JHAs, MOCs, FMEAs, PSM, or functional safety design

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
